Drive operational excellence and employee success as an HR Manager at our Lewisville Fulfillment Center.

The opportunity:

The People team is at the heart of Flexport's growth, ensuring we attract, develop, and retain the best talent to redefine global trade. As an Onsite Human Resources Manager, you will be the dedicated HR leader for our rapidly expanding Lewisville, Texas Fulfillment Center. This is a hands-on role where you will partner directly with FC leadership, managing all HR functions for a large, dynamic workforce. You'll be instrumental in shaping the employee experience, fostering a positive culture, and ensuring our operations run smoothly and compliantly.

You will:

  • Serve as the primary HR partner for the Lewisville Fulfillment Center, advising leadership on all people-related matters.
  • Manage the full employee lifecycle for our workforce, including, onboarding, performance management, and offboarding.
  • Lead employee relations efforts, conducting investigations, mediating conflicts, and ensuring fair and consistent application of policies.
  • Drive HR program implementation at the site level, including performance reviews, compensation cycles, and employee engagement initiatives.
  • Ensure compliance with all federal, state, and local employment laws and Flexport policies within the fulfillment center.
  • Analyze HR data to identify trends, recommend solutions, and contribute to site-specific HR strategies.

You should have:

  • 5+ years of progressive HR experience, with at least 2 years in an onsite operational environment (e.g., fulfillment center, manufacturing, warehouse).
  • Proven expertise in employee relations, labor law compliance, and HR best practices for non-exempt workforces.
  • Strong ability to partner with and influence site leadership to achieve business and people objectives.
  • Experience managing HR functions independently for a specific site or business unit.
  • Excellent communication, problem-solving, and organizational skills.
  • A 'compliance first' attitude to keep our regulators happy and enthusiastic about Flexport since we operate in a heavily regulated industry.
